MY EARLY LIFE AS A CHILD


when I was a child
I lived without time
never gave it second thought

I lived in the now
there was no before or after
I was merely me

being me
in an eternal
present

much like the cat
who never gave tomorrow
the time of day

it appeared that I
had always existed
and would forever do

just
to be
that was me

a piece of sunlight
tripping over a stone
a footstep left in mud

was world enough
to be going on with
just to be the miracle

time it seemed
had never owned me
I was just Planet DΓ³nall

Dempsey-ing along
to my heart's content
laughter my only language

in love with
a world and the world
madly in love with me
Donall Dempsey
